Trucking and real estate stocks struggle to gain momentum on Friday after becoming latest victims of AI fears

AI fears gripped equity markets once more to trigger a fresh sell-off on Thursday.

TL;DR

  • Logistics and real estate stocks experienced a sell-off due to renewed AI concerns.
  • Tools like Algorhythm's SemiCab are contributing to fears in the logistics sector.
  • Major logistics companies like C.H. Robinson and RXO saw significant drops but partially rebounded.
  • Commercial real estate companies, including CBRE and Jones Lang LaSalle, also faced losses.
  • Software stocks, previously hit by a sell-off, showed mixed performance after being caught in Thursday's drawdown.
  • UBS strategists view AI's impact as a validation of its monetization potential and recommend sector diversification.
  • Dan Ives suggests that Wall Street is miscalculating AI's broad impact on the tech sector, causing a significant dislocation in software stock prices.
